Instructions

  1. 1
    Sponge cake base: Separate 5 eggs. Whip egg yolks with 3.5 oz (100g) sugar until creamy (ribbon stage). Whip egg whites with a pinch of salt until stiff peaks form, then sprinkle in 1.8 oz (50g) sugar. Sift together flour (4.2 oz / 120g) and baking powder (1 tsp). Fold egg yolk mixture and egg white foam alternately with flour—light and airy. Bake in a 9x13 in (23x33cm) pan at 347°F (175°C) for 25 minutes.
  2. 2
    Cannabis Tres Leches Mix: "Three milks"—the soul of the cake. Mix 13.5 fl oz (400ml) sweetened condensed milk, 13.5 fl oz (400ml) evaporated milk, 6.8 fl oz (200ml) heavy cream, 4 tbsp cannabis oil (MCT-based—emulsifies optimally in milk fats), 1 tsp vanilla extract, and 1 tbsp dark rum. Whisk well.
  3. 3
    Soaking: Remove warm cake from pan. Perforate densely with a wooden skewer or fork—every centimeter. Pour the milk mixture over the cake in spoonfuls and let it soak in. Don't add it all at once—do it in 3–4 batches with 5-minute waits between. The cake should be incredibly moist but not fall apart.
  4. 4
    Chilling: Cover and refrigerate for at least 4 hours, preferably overnight. The cake continues to absorb. The next day: noticeably juicier, deeper flavors. Tres Leches is one of the few cake recipes where overnight resting is essential.
  5. 5
    Whipped cream topping: Whip 13.5 fl oz (400ml) heavy cream with 3 tbsp powdered sugar and 1 tsp vanilla until soft and creamy (not stiff). Spread over chilled cake. Garnish with fresh berries, coconut flakes, or caramel sauce. Serve and plate pieces immediately. Onset: 60–90 minutes.

Frequently Asked Questions

How long do edibles take to kick in?
Cannabis edibles typically take 30–90 minutes to kick in, depending on your metabolism, body weight, and whether you've eaten recently. Always wait at least 2 hours before consuming more to avoid overconsumption.
How do I calculate the THC dosage for Cannabis Tres Leches?
Use our THC Edibles Calculator to calculate the exact THC mg per serving based on your strain's potency and the amount of cannabis used. A common starting dose for beginners is 5–10 mg THC per serving.
Can I freeze Cannabis Tres Leches?
Yes, cannabis baked goods freeze well for up to 3 months. Wrap individual pieces tightly in cling film and store in a freezer bag. Thaw at room temperature for 1–2 hours before serving.
Can I replace cannabis oil with cannabutter in this recipe?
Yes, cannabutter and cannabis oil are interchangeable in most baked recipes. Use equal amounts by weight. Cannabutter tends to give a richer flavor, while cannabis coconut oil creates a lighter texture.
